Palmetto Bluff is nestled along the May River in the Lowcountry of South Carolina between Hilton Head Island and Savannah. As an award-winning 20,000-acre development, the development encompasses a private member-only club, which includes a marina, restaurants, an equestrian center, a shooting club, a Jack Nicklaus Signature Golf Course, a lawn and racquet club, and more. In addition, Palmetto Bluff has an extensive nature preserve, walking trails, retail shopping, and a vibrant village, all of which pay homage to the region’s rich heritage.

Job Summary:

The PB Outfitters Manager oversees the daily operations of the retail store, including managing inventory, store displays, establishing SOPs and procedures, as well as training, onboarding, and scheduling retail associates. The PB Outfitters Manager will partner with the Director of Retail to outline, enforce, and set strategies, programs, and systems focusing on continuous sales growth, guest loyalty, and retention.

The PB Outfitters Manager will order, re-order, and work with the Director of Retail and vendors to bring in new products for the store. The PB Outfitters Manager will warmly greet all visitors, offer direction, and will be knowledgeable of the store products offered; will actively maintain the image of the store by organizing and restocking as needed inside the store; will process transactions, as well as handle refunds and exchanges.

The PB Outfitters Manager is an ambassador of Palmetto Bluff and will be expected to be knowledgeable about all amenities and experiences available on the property.

Essential Job Functions:

Job duties include, although are not limited to:

Strong focus on creating a brand identity for PB Outfitters by establishing a distinct style of product offered to members and guests. Recommend new product introductions.

Maintain store staff by recruiting, selecting, orientating, and training employees.

Complete weekly schedule for retail attendants per policy and oversee payroll processing in a timely and accurate manner.

Direct and supervise retail staff to ensure all standards and objectives are met.

Provide training to retail employees to develop their skills and enhance their job performance to ensure superior guest service and experience.

Responsible for the proper maintenance of the retail store under control, ensuring that the stock, furniture, and fittings are in excellent condition.

Maintain retail displays, replenishing and rearranging stock as necessary.

Manage inventory control to include establishing pars and reorder SOPs, ordering, and receiving products (both physically as well as entering inventory software)

Process and record purchase orders per policy.

Focus on high turnover and minimize overstock of products to avoid markdowns at all times.

Process invoices for payment in an accurate and timely manner per policy

Conduct quarterly physical inventory, input totals, and reconcile variances to sales.

Partner with the Director of Retail in implementing budget plans for the store and developing merchandising/brand standards and guidelines.

Evaluate operational and financial records to determine the sales performance of the retail store.

Ensure that profitability goals are met by driving revenue and maintaining the budgeted cost of sales.

Secure merchandise by implementing security systems and measures.

In concert with the Director of Retail and other outlet managers, assist as required in all retail outlets.

Greet all guests warmly upon arrival.

Aid guests in the retail shop, both by telephone and in person.

Actively sell merchandise to achieve daily sales goals.

Accurately process payments per established standards

Promote positive relations with guests and staff members.

Attend meetings and training sessions as required.

Ensure compliance with health/safety policies and procedures in retail outlets.

Promote a positive work environment in all areas.
